Essential Responsibilities/Duties

  • Abide by company safety guidelines
  • Load and unload raw materials and equipment
  • Set up and calibrate accessories and equipment
  • Keep detailed records of equipment and procedures
  • Perform necessary maintenance and cleaning on equipment
  • Supervise machines as they run and make adjustments as needed
  • Inspect tooling details to ensure compliance
  • Machining of tooling details and material prep to support the tool room utilizing mill, lathe, saw, and other support equipment
  • Support off-shift manufacturing equipment breakdowns
  • Support off-shift maintenance requirements such as floor cleaning, preventative maintenance, etc., as needed
